    Hi all, I’m not new to Train Simulator games. But in every timetable or scenario except “Powering America” in TSW2 I can’t seem to get the AC4400 with Rolling stock to move past 0.1MPH AT ALL.

    Yes the all the switches seem to be correct including Generator Field ON, all brakes released, reverser Forward. When I move the throttle handle anything past N4 the wheels just slip and the train lags a bit. Anything past N4 the train spazzes a bit and it’s all slip.

    Anything before N4 the train does not move at all. I could operate the train in the Powering America Scenario just fine and used the same steps in Timetables as well.

    Have you pressed the buttons on the operators screen? It’s just if you haven’t then the brakes are still on/not set correctly.

    There’s a tutorial specifically for this loco but sure it’s button 1 then F3 then F6 to set correctly. After this is done N2/N3 should start you rolling.

    Indeed, from the manual for the AC4400CW:

    9. The correct settings are:

    Feed Valve: 90psi (use F1/F2 on the IFD Keypad to adjust if needed)

    Auto Brake: Cut in (use F3 on the IFD Keypad to toggle if needed)

    Independent Brake: Lead (Use F4 on the IFD Keypad to toggle if needed)

    10. If you made any changes, press F6 on the IFD Keypad to make those changes Active.

    11. Press F8 on the IFD Keypad to exit the Air Brake Setup screen.

    ...if the train has helper units in it, and you’re trying to make use of them, you need to do the following. Good luck, let me know how it works out.

    - Configure the two engines at the front of the train as a standard lead-trail pair
    - Configure the two helpers further back in the train as a standard lead-trail pair
    - Make sure the Radio circuit breaker in both lead units are on (they should be on by default)
    - Finally, turn on the banking radio *only* in the lead unit at the front of the train (by hitting the ‘DISP’ button on the front of it), and that should bring up the helpers
